Abstract

The present invention relates to the technical field of cargo packing optimization, and provides an e-commerce order packing optimization method based on a genetic algorithm and a heuristic strategy, which divides an e-commerce order into naked delivery goods and non-naked delivery goods; How much is the quantity? Choose to use enumeration method, genetic algorithm combined with block processing, or modular method to get the logistics cost of non-naked delivery goods for different couriers; add up naked delivery goods and non-naked delivery goods to get e-commerce orders For the total logistics cost and packing scheme of different express providers; output the express provider and packing plan corresponding to the lowest total logistics cost. According to the order characteristics of e-commerce platform enterprises, the present invention designs a set of high-efficiency packing optimization method, which flexibly considers the optional situation of multiple box types and multiple express delivery; through reasonable planning of packing scheme, the trial and error of workers when packing is reduced. The wrong time can help improve packaging efficiency, and at the same time reduce the total logistics cost of the order including carton and express delivery costs. The solution is simple and feasible, and has promotional significance.

Description

technical field [0001] The invention relates to the technical field of cargo packing optimization, in particular to an e-commerce order packing optimization method based on a genetic algorithm and a heuristic strategy, which can reasonably plan a cargo packing scheme for e-commerce platform enterprises according to order characteristics. Background technique [0002] In recent years, the e-commerce industry is developing rapidly. How to reduce logistics costs is a common challenge faced by e-commerce platform companies. Online customer orders are generally picked and delivered by e-commerce warehouses, and cartons for packaging and express delivery account for a large proportion of enterprise logistics costs. Reasonable planning of the packing scheme in the packing of goods can help enterprises reduce the cost of carton consumption and express delivery costs.
